Hereford v Southport Match Preview

Southport take to the road on Saturday with a trip to Hereford kick off 3pm.

Both sides suffered defeats on Tuesday and will be looking to bounce back. Hereford went down 3-0 at the much improved Curzon Ashton whilst we of course lost our unbeaten home record to a very impressive Blyth Spartans side who belied their lowly position and were worthy winners.

Tyler Walton was laid low with illness and missing other players through injury Southport struggled on the night. Liam said after the game that some of the injuries are starting to clear and that will be music to all Southport fans ears as we enter the final 15 games of the season.

There have been some interesting games between the two sides down the years with the sides facing each other twice as Football League sides, the first occasion being in our 1972/73 promotion season when over 10000 saw a brilliant 2-2 draw on Boxing Day. The Southport scorers that day were Jim Fryatt and Norrie Lloyd.
